Show GIVE UP HOPE OF . IDENTIFYING BODIES HONOLULU, Sept. The cleariag of debris from the submarine F-4, whieh WU lost outside Honolulu bar bor March 25 with alT hands, and which was raised reoenth and is now in dry dock here, is practically completed. The hull will be towed to Pearl harbor to awaitf such disposition as the navy department de-partment may order. Little hope is entertained of further identifications of the bodies of the twenty-two nien who perished in the submarine, most of the remains being unrecognizable fragments. The officials in charge of the F-4 operations are reticent regarding the significance of the conditions thir in vestigation revealed and refer all inquiries in-quiries to Washington. |
